OverviewThe CC2541 is a power‑optimized wireless MCU system‑on‑chip (SoC) for Bluetooth Low Energy (BLE) and proprietary 2.4‑GHz applications. It integrates an RF transceiver, an enhanced 8051 MCU core, in‑system programmable flash (128 KB or 256 KB), 8 KB RAM and multiple peripherals to enable compact, low‑BOM wireless nodes with ultralow power consumption.
Key features- 2.4‑GHz RF SoC supporting Bluetooth Low Energy and proprietary modes
- Data rates: 250 kbps, 500 kbps, 1 Mbps and 2 Mbps
- Programmable TX up to 0 dBm and receiver sensitivity down to −94 dBm (1 Mbps)
- Pin‑compatible with CC2540 in 6 mm × 6 mm QFN‑40 when certain USB / I2C extra I/O are not used
- Available in CC2541F128 (128 KB) and CC2541F256 (256 KB) flash variants
RF and regulatory- Designed for worldwide radio regulations (ETSI EN 300 328 / EN 300 440 Class 2; FCC CFR47 Part 15; ARIB STD‑T66)
- Excellent link budget for extended range without external RF front‑end in many applications
- Programmable output power and good selectivity / blocking performance
Layout & packaging- Minimal external components required; reference designs available
- 6 mm × 6 mm QFN‑40 (VQFN RHA) package
- Pin compatibility considerations with CC2540 when USB or extra I2C/I/O are not used
Low power operation- Active RX down to 17.9 mA; Active TX (0 dBm) ~18.2 mA
- Power Mode 1 (4 µs wake‑up): 270 µA
- Power Mode 2 (sleep timer on): 1 µA
- Power Mode 3 (external interrupts): 0.5 µA
- Wide supply range: 2.0 V – 3.6 V
Microcontroller & memory- Enhanced 8051 MCU core with code prefetch for improved code throughput
- In‑system programmable flash: 128 KB or 256 KB
- 8 KB RAM with retention across power modes
- Hardware debug support and baseband automation (auto‑ack, address decoding)
Peripherals- 12‑bit ADC, 8 channels (configurable resolution)
- 2 × SPI, 2 × UART (USART), 4 timers, I2C interface
- Five‑channel DMA, IR generation, 32‑kHz sleep timer with capture
- Accurate digital RSSI, battery monitor, temperature sensor
- 23 GPIOs (21 × 4 mA, 2 × 20 mA), 2 I/O with LED drive capability
- AES security coprocessor, watchdog timer, high‑performance comparator
Security- Cryptographic acceleration and AES‑128 support
- Device attestation & anti‑counterfeit features
- Secure debug and software IP protection
Development tools & software- Evaluation kits: CC2541EMK, CC2541DK‑MINI
- SmartRF tools, BTool, IAR Embedded Workbench support and CC‑Debugger
- Sample applications and BLE v4.0 single‑mode stack (GAP/GATT/SMP/L2CAP)
- Flexible configuration: single‑chip application or network‑processor interface
Product parameters (summary)- CPU core: Enhanced 8051
- Technology: 2.4 GHz Bluetooth Low Energy
- Flash memory: 128 KB (CC2541F128) or 256 KB (CC2541F256)
- RAM: 8 KB
- GPIOs: 23
- Sensitivity (best): −94 dBm (1 Mbps)
- Operating temp.: −40 °C to 85 °C
- Package: 6 × 6 mm QFN‑40
- Supply voltage: 2.0 V – 3.6 V
Technical specifications- Type: Wireless MCU (SoC)
- Peripherals: 12‑bit ADC (8 ch), 2 SPI, 2 UART, 4 timers, I2C, 5‑channel DMA
- Max TX power: programmable up to 0 dBm
- Low‑power modes with sleep currents down to 0.5 µA
- Regulatory targets: ETSI / FCC / ARIB compliance guidance